Output 379ac4aadf7d9d007ea9baffb690c94d074b3bb7522e18b0e74da038a39d6668:37

value
12908520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ad14ac61e541937926f1528f16b28e57e91fc812 OP_EQUAL
address
MPgKu2ZRCAuNTyLgZnjjwUfWsRdNXaBgKB
transaction
379ac4aadf7d9d007ea9baffb690c94d074b3bb7522e18b0e74da038a39d6668
spent
true